Carefully composed portrait of a man and two women, likely siblings or a young family group, seated closely together in a sixth plate daguerreotype. The man, positioned at left, holds a document or folded paper in one hand, his attire consisting of a high-collared shirt, dark waistcoat, and formal jacket with watch chain. To his right, the central figure gazes directly into the camera with a composed and serious expression, her dress adorned with a bright floral brooch. At far right, another woman, slightly turned toward her companions, wears a wide-patterned sash and lace collar, her folded hands resting in her lap.

The visual interplay between the sitters and the object in hand introduces a note of narrative, possibly suggesting shared responsibilities or intellectual pursuits. The daguerreotype is housed in a finely tooled leather case with a red velvet pad, typical of mid-19th century portrait presentation. A strikingly clear and intimate image that captures the strength of familial or social bonds through balanced composition and quietly expressive detail.
